Travel Green Wisconsin Score

68

To be certified through Travel Green Wisconsin, all participants must achieve at least 30 points on the Travel Green Wisconsin Checklist. The more points a business attains, the greener they are in their operations.

Green Innovations

  • Ecncourage guests to boat responsibly, including collecting garbage, observing 'no wake' zones and practicing 'Catch, Photo. Release' for large fish
  • Resort organizes day trips to visit local attractions and restaurants or to take biking, hiking, or sightseeing trips
  • Local and organic products are purchased and paper products contain recycled content
  • Worked with the DNR on a Lakeshore Restoration Project
  • The majority of light bulbs have been replaced with compact fluorescents
